Summary:
Every organization needs insight to succeed and excel, and the primary foundation for insights today is data--whether it's internal data from operational systems or external data from partners, vendors, and public sources. But how can you use this data to create and maintain analytics applications capable of gaining real insights in real time? In this report, Darin Briskman explains that leading organizations like Netflix, Walmart, and Confluent have found that while traditional analytics still have value, it's not enough. These companies and many others are now building real-time analytics that deliver insights continually, on demand, and at scale--complete with interactive drill-down data conversations, subsecond performance at scale, and always-on reliability.
